Description

The Factoring Purchase Agreement with Bank in Wayne is designed to facilitate the sale and assignment of accounts receivable from a seller (Client) to a factor (Bank), thereby providing the Client with immediate cash flow. Key features of this agreement include the assignment of accounts receivable as absolute ownership, terms for sales and delivery of merchandise, and credit approval processes. It stipulates that any sales and deliveries made by the Client must be approved by the Factor’s credit department, ensuring that only creditworthy sales are financed. The agreement also addresses risks associated with credit and insolvency, specifying which party assumes losses as well as outlining procedures for handling returns and disputes. Clients must keep the Factor informed of all financial activity related to the assigned receivables and are required to provide regular financial statements. The agreement further emphasizes the importance of written documentation in altering any obligations and details the governing law and arbitration processes for resolving disputes. What is bank factoring? The name, bankfactoring, might suggest that it is the bank that provides factoring services, but this is a simplification. It is not the banks, but actually companies specifically delegated by them to use bank capital, that offer factoring.

Documents you will have to provide: Factoring application. Articles of Association or registered Amendments to the Articles of Association of your company. Annual report for the previous financial year. Financial report (balance sheet andf profit/loss statement) for the current year (for 3, 6 or 9 months, respectively)

The Most Common Invoice Factoring Requirements A factoring application. An accounts receivable aging report. A copy of your Articles of Incorporation. Invoices to factor. Credit-worthy clients. A business bank account. A tax ID number. A form of personal identification.

Factoring companies will typically run a background check. While less-than-perfect backgrounds can be approved for factoring, certain violent or financial crimes may be disqualifying.
